What is Collinese?


1.

A form of communication (both written and oral) in which the user diverts from the intended topic of discussion as a means of avoiding committting themselves to a definite answer. This diversionary tactic is normally accompanied by misspellings and a very low standard of grammar designed to further confuse and infuriate the questioner.

" I asked him a simple question and 30 minutes later he was still talking collinese"

" He was asked for a straightforward 'yes or no' and replied with a 'nes' !!"
